Application Won't Start¶
Problem: Port Already in Use¶
Solution:
# Find process using port 8000
lsof -i :8000
# Gracefully stop the process
kill <PID>
# If the process does not stop after a few seconds, force-kill it:
kill -9 <PID>
# Or start File Organizer on a different port
file-organizer serve --port 8001
# When using Docker Compose, edit the ports mapping in docker-compose.yml:
# ports:
# - "8001:8001" # change both sides to match your chosen port
# Then set FO_PORT so the app binds to the same port inside the container:
echo "FO_PORT=8001" >> .env
docker-compose up -d
Problem: Database Connection Failed¶
Solution:
# Verify database URL
echo $DATABASE_URL
# Test connection
psql $DATABASE_URL -c "SELECT 1;"
# Check if PostgreSQL is running
docker-compose ps db
# Restart database
docker-compose restart db

High CPU Usage¶
Problem: Application consuming excessive CPU
Solution:
# Monitor CPU usage
docker stats
# Find slow queries
docker-compose exec db psql -U user -d file_organizer \
-c "SELECT * FROM pg_stat_statements WHERE mean_time > 1000;"
# Kill slow queries
docker-compose exec db psql -U user -d file_organizer \
-c "SELECT pg_terminate_backend(pid) FROM pg_stat_activity WHERE state = 'active' AND query_start < NOW() - interval '5 min';"

API Issues¶
401 Unauthorized¶
Problem: API requests returning 401
Solution:
API keys follow the format fo_<id>_<token> and must be sent via the X-API-Key header.
Auth header
Use X-API-Key: YOUR_API_KEY, not Authorization: Bearer YOUR_API_KEY. Bearer tokens are not supported for API key authentication.

Database Issues¶
Slow Queries¶
Problem: Database queries running slow
Solution:
# Enable query logging
docker-compose exec db psql -U user -d file_organizer \
-c "ALTER SYSTEM SET log_min_duration_statement = 1000;"
# Reload configuration
docker-compose exec db psql -U user -c "SELECT pg_reload_conf();"
# Analyze slow queries
docker-compose exec db psql -U user -d file_organizer \
-c "SELECT * FROM pg_stat_statements ORDER BY mean_time DESC LIMIT 10;"
Connection Pool Exhausted¶
Problem: "Too many connections" error
Solution:
# Check active connections
docker-compose exec db psql -U user -d file_organizer \
-c "SELECT count(*) FROM pg_stat_activity;"
# Increase pool size
DATABASE_POOL_SIZE=30 docker-compose up -d
# Kill idle connections
docker-compose exec db psql -U user -d file_organizer \
-c "SELECT pg_terminate_backend(pid) FROM pg_stat_activity WHERE state = 'idle';"

Reverse Proxy Issues¶
Problem: Behind Nginx/Apache, requests fail
Solution:
# Ensure proper headers
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_set_header X-Forwarded-Proto $scheme;
# WebSocket support
proxy_http_version 1.1;
proxy_set_header Upgrade $http_upgrade;
proxy_set_header Connection "upgrade";

Redis Issues¶
Redis Connection Failed¶
Problem: ConnectionError: Error connecting to Redis or session/cache features not working
Solution:
# Check the configured Redis URL
echo $FO_REDIS_URL
# Verify the Redis container is running
docker-compose ps redis
# Restart the Redis container if it is stopped/unhealthy
docker-compose restart redis
# Test the connection directly from the Redis container.
# REDISCLI_AUTH is already set in the container environment (docker-compose.yml),
# so redis-cli authenticates automatically — no password argument needed.
docker-compose exec redis redis-cli ping
# Expected output: PONG
Redis Memory Pressure / Eviction¶
Problem: Cache misses increase, or Redis logs maxmemory policy: allkeys-lru evictions
Solution:
# Check Redis memory usage
docker-compose exec redis redis-cli info memory | grep used_memory_human
# Check current eviction policy
docker-compose exec redis redis-cli config get maxmemory-policy
# If eviction is too aggressive, increase the memory limit in docker-compose.yml
# or in your Redis configuration:
# maxmemory 512mb
# maxmemory-policy allkeys-lru
docker-compose restart redis
Clearing the Redis Cache (Safe)¶
Only do this when debugging stale cache data. Flushing removes all cached sessions and data.
# Flush only the File Organizer database (default: db 0)
docker-compose exec redis redis-cli -n 0 FLUSHDB
# Restart the app after clearing
docker-compose restart file-organizer
Redis Auth / TLS Errors¶
Problem: NOAUTH Authentication required or TLS handshake failure
Solution:
The Compose stack reads REDIS_PASSWORD from .env and injects it into both the Redis service and the app's FO_REDIS_URL. Exporting a shell variable will not reach the container — set it in .env instead:
# Edit .env (copy from .env.example if it doesn't exist yet)
# Set a strong password — avoid special URI characters (@ : / # %)
echo "REDIS_PASSWORD=your_strong_password" >> .env
docker-compose up -d
For an external TLS-enabled Redis (e.g., Redis Cloud, Azure Cache for Redis), update FO_REDIS_URL in docker-compose.yml directly to use the rediss:// scheme and external hostname:
# docker-compose.yml — under the file-organizer service's environment:
- FO_REDIS_URL=rediss://:your_password@hostname.redis.cloud:6380/0

Deployment Rollback¶
Note: This section covers rolling back the application version in a Docker deployment. To undo individual file organization operations, see Operation Undo / Rollback in the User Troubleshooting Guide.
Roll Back to a Previous Source Version¶
The default docker-compose.yml builds the image from source (build: context: .). To roll back to a previous release, check out the target git tag and rebuild:
# Identify the release tag to roll back to
git tag --sort=-version:refname | head -10
# Check out the previous release
git checkout v2.0.0-alpha.3 # replace with the target tag
# Rebuild and redeploy
docker-compose build
docker-compose up -d
If your deployment uses a pre-built registry image instead of a local build, edit the image: field directly in docker-compose.yml:
# docker-compose.yml
services:
file-organizer:
image: ghcr.io/curdriceaurora/local-file-organizer:2.0.0-alpha.3
# Remove or comment out the 'build:' block when pinning an image tag

Database Migration Rollback¶
If a new version ran Alembic migrations and you need to revert:
# Identify the previous migration revision
docker-compose exec file-organizer alembic history --indicate-current
# Downgrade one step
docker-compose exec file-organizer alembic downgrade -1
# Or downgrade to a specific revision ID
docker-compose exec file-organizer alembic downgrade <revision_id>
Always take a database backup before rolling back migrations in production.
Getting Help¶
Collect Diagnostic Information¶
# System info
uname -a
docker --version
docker-compose --version
# Application logs
docker-compose logs web > web.log
docker-compose logs db > db.log
# Configuration (without secrets)
env | grep -v PASSWORD | grep -v SECRET | grep -v KEY > env.log
# Resource usage
docker stats --no-stream > stats.log
df -h > disk.log
